=
(2,8285-3,5355)2
+ (1,8741-1,8741)2 + (2,9814)2
……..
=
Public
Class Form1
Sub
buatTabel()
LV.Columns.add("KP",
80, horizontalalignment.center)
LV.Columns.add("Nama",
180, HorizontalAlignment.Left)
LV.view = View.Details
LV.gridlines() = True
LV.FullRowSelect = True
End Sub
Sub
isiTabel()
Dim Lst
As New
ListViewItem
Lst.Text = KP.Text
Lst.SubItems.Add(Nama.Text)
LV.Items.Add(Lst)
End Sub
Private Sub Form1_Load(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les MyBase.Load
buatTabel()
KP.Items.Add("TOK-MED-100")
KP.Items.Add("PAB-BEL-101")
KP.Items.Add("SWA-BEL-102")
KP.Items.Add("PAB-MED-103")
KP.Items.Add("RUM-MED-104")
End Sub
Private Sub
KP_SelectedIndexChanged(ByVal sender As System.Object, ByVal
e As System.EventArgs) Handles
KP.SelectedIndexChanged
Dim x As String
x =
Microsoft.VisualBasic.Right(KP.Text, 3)
If x = "100" Then
Nama.Text = "Muhammad Ardianto"
ElseIf
x = "101" Then
Nama.Text = "Jekson Sinaga"
ElseIf
x = "102" Then
Nama.Text = "Triani Arista"
ElseIf
x = "103" Then
Nama.Text = "Aldyan"
End If
x = Microsoft.VisualBasic.Left(KP.Text,
3)
If x = "PAB" Then
HargaM3.Text = 500
Bbeban.Text = 250000
Tipe.Text = "Pabrik"
ElseIf
x = "TOK" Then
HargaM3.Text = 500
Bbeban.Text = 25000
Tipe.Text = "Toko"
ElseIf
x = "RUM" Then
HargaM3.Text = 500
Bbeban.Text = 10000
Tipe.Text = "Rumah"
ElseIf
x = "SWA" Then
HargaM3.Text = 200
Bbeban.Text = 15000
Tipe.Text = "Swalayan"
End If
x = Microsoft.VisualBasic.Mid(KP.Text,
5, 3)
If x = "MED" Then
Daerah.Text = "Medan"
ElseIf
x = "BEL" Then
Daerah.Text = "Belawan"
End If
End Sub
Private Sub Pemakaian_KeyPress(ByVal
sender As Object,
ByVal e As
System.Windows.Forms.KeyPressEventArgs) Handles
Pemakaian.KeyPress
If
Asc(e.KeyChar) = 13 Then
Ttagihan.Text = HargaM3.Text *
Pemakaian.Text + Val(Bbeban.Text)
Pajak.Text = 0.01 * Ttagihan.Text
Pembayaran.Text =
Val(Ttagihan.Text) + Val(Pajak.Text)
End If
End Sub
Private Sub Button1_Click(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les button1.Click
End
End Sub
Private Sub btnHapus_Click(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les button1.Click
KP.Text = ""
Nama.Text = ""
Tipe.Text = ""
Ttagihan.Text = ""
HargaM3.Text = ""
Pajak.Text = ""
Pembayaran.Text = ""
Pemakaian.Text = ""
Daerah.Text = ""
Bbeban.Text = ""
End Sub
Private Sub Proses_Click(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les Proses.Click
isiTabel()
KP.Text = ""
Nama.Text = ""
End Sub
Private Sub ListView1_SelectedIndexChanged(ByVal sender As
System.Object, ByVal e As
System.EventArgs) Handles
LV.SelectedIndexChanged
End Sub
End
Class
Public Class Form1
Private Sub NPM_SelectedIndexChanged(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les
NPM.SelectedIndexChanged
Select Case NPM.Text
Case
"12110260"
nama.Text = "Rasimin"
Case
"12110261"
nama.Text = "Gareth"
Case
"12110263"
nama.Text = "Edo"
Case
"12110147"
nama.Text = "r4bia"
Case
"12021687"
nama.Text = "Putra S."
Case
"12008778"
nama.Text = "Yanu"
Case
"12110756"
nama.Text = "Fahmi Latief"
Case
"12110304"
nama.Text = "Vicky Faldhy Agita"
End Select
End Sub
Private Sub Form1_Load(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les MyBase.Load
NPM.Items.Add("12110260")
NPM.Items.Add("12110261")
NPM.Items.Add("12110263")
NPM.Items.Add("12110147")
NPM.Items.Add("12021687")
NPM.Items.Add("12008778")
NPM.Items.Add("12110756")
NPM.Items.Add("12110304")
Kdosen.Items.Add("1198777")
Kdosen.Items.Add("1198888")
Kdosen.Items.Add("1198999")
kmatakuliah.Items.Add("A111")
kmatakuliah.Items.Add("B222")
kmatakuliah.Items.Add("C333")
Dim i As Integer
For i =
1 To 100
Ntugas.Items.Add(i)
Nuas.Items.Add(i)
Nkhadiran.Items.Add(i)
Nuts.Items.Add(i)
Next
End Sub
Private Sub Kdosen_SelectedIndexChanged(ByVal sender As
System.Object, ByVal e As
System.EventArgs) Handles
Kdosen.SelectedIndexChanged
Select Case Kdosen.Text
Case
"1198777"
namadosen.Text = "Guidio Tarigan s.kom, M.kom"
Case
"1198888"
namadosen.Text = "Abdul sani sembiring s.kom, M.kom"
Case
"1198999"
namadosen.Text = "Pilipus Tarigan s.T, M.kom"
End Select
End Sub
Private Sub kmatakuliah_SelectedIndexChanged(ByVal sender As
System.Object, ByVal e As
System.EventArgs) Handles
kmatakuliah.SelectedIndexChanged
Select Case kmatakuliah.Text
Case
"A111"
nmatakuliah.Text = "Komunikasi Data"
Case
"B222"
nmatakuliah.Text = "Sistem Operasi"
Case
"C333"
nmatakuliah.Text = "Arsitektur dan Organisasi Komputer"
End Select
End Sub
Private Sub BTNPROSES_Click(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les BTNPROSES.Click
If
NPM.Text = "" Or Nkhadiran.Text = ""
Or Nuts.Text = ""
Or Ntugas.Text = ""
Or Nuas.Text = ""
Then
MsgBox("Pastikan
NPM/nilai sudah ter input")
ElseIf
NPM.Text Then
Nakhir.Text = Val(0.1 *
Nkhadiran.Text) + Val(0.15 * Ntugas.Text) + Val(0.3 * Nuts.Text) + Val(0.45 *
Nuas.Text)
If
Nakhir.Text >= 90 Then
Nhuruf.Text = "A"
ElseIf
Nakhir.Text >= 80 Then
Nhuruf.Text = "B+"
ElseIf
Nakhir.Text >= 70 Then
Nhuruf.Text = "B"
ElseIf
Nakhir.Text >= 60 Then
Nhuruf.Text = "C"
ElseIf
Nakhir.Text >= 50 Then
Nhuruf.Text = "D"
Else
Nhuruf.Text = "E"
End
If
If
Nakhir.Text >= 50 Then
xket.Text = "LULUS"
Else
xket.Text = "GAGAL"
End
If
Dim
x, y As String
x =
Microsoft.VisualBasic.Mid(NPM.Text, 3, 2)
y =
Microsoft.VisualBasic.Mid(NPM.Text, 5, 1)
If
x = "11" Then
jenjang.Text = "S1"
ElseIf
x = "02" Then
jenjang.Text = "D3"
ElseIf x
= "00" Then
jenjang.Text = "D1"
End
If
If
y = "0" Then
jurusan.Text = "Tehnik Informatika"
ElseIf
y = "1" Then
jurusan.Text = "Management informatika"
ElseIf y
= "8" Then
jurusan.Text = "Teknisi Komputer"
ElseIf
y = "5" Then
End
If
End If
End Sub
Private Sub BTNHAPUS_Click(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les BTNHAPUS.Click
NPM.Text = ""
nama.Text = ""
jenjang.Text = ""
Kdosen.Text = ""
namadosen.Text = ""
kmatakuliah.Text = ""
nmatakuliah.Text = ""
Nkhadiran.Text = ""
Ntugas.Text = ""
Nuts.Text = ""
Nuas.Text = ""
Nakhir.Text = ""
Nhuruf.Text = ""
xket.Text = ""
jurusan.Text = ""
End Sub
Private Sub BTNKELUAR_Click(ByVal
sender As System.Object, ByVal e As
System.EventArgs) Handles BTNKELUAR.Click
End
End Sub
End Class
Blogger templates
Blogger news
Blogger templates
Diberdayakan oleh Blogger.



